Department Overview:
The IBD Product control team supports the Investment Banking division as well as the Syndication desks in Global Markets. Product Control is responsible for Daily PL Reporting, Flash to Actual analysis, Front to Back reconciliations, P&L Commentary, Manual Adjustment review, Month-end general ledger close, Balance Sheet Attestation & Reconciliation, Quarterly Financial Reporting, assist with Internal and External Auditors, and ad-hoc analysis. Works closely with Banking deal teams, Syndicate trading desks, Middle Office/Ops, Financial Reporting, Regulatory, IPV teams, and Internal and External Auditors.
Role Description / Areas of responsibility:
- Responsible for timely daily & monthly reporting of P&L, analysis, and commentary.
- Analyze and explain flash versus actual P&L variances, monitor front to back processes to ensure sufficient controls and investigation on breaks.
- Support the Banking teams, front office traders, ability to work with inter-departments to pursue business and control solutions.
- Work closely with trading desk & operations to resolve any trade booking and/or valuation issues.
- Perform month-end reconciliations on P&L and balance sheet, and monitor intercompany receivables/payables.
- Work closely with Banking deal teams on calculating new deal returns and communicating in a timely fashion to senior front office and finance management.
- Take responsibility for the accuracy of the firm’s financial books and records.
- Participate in new projects and initiatives, ad-hoc issues and system enhancement UAT.
- Provide information and support to internal and external auditors.
- Responsible for quarterly financial reporting and Americas Portfolio Returns presentations.
